Table of Contents

Preface Acknowledgments 1. Teaching Counseling Students Today 2. Orientation to Professional Counseling Courses 3. Ethics Courses 4. Counseling Theories Courses 5. Diversity Courses 6. Life-Span Development Courses 7. Counseling Techniques Courses 8. Career Development Courses 9. Group Counseling Courses 10. Research Courses 11. Diagnosis, Assessment, and Treatment Planning Courses 12. Practicum and Internship Courses 13. Marriage, Couple, and Family Counseling Courses 14. School Counseling Courses 15. In-Class Activities Appendix: Council for Accreditation of Counseling and Related Educational Programs (CACREP) Alignment Index

Jude T. Austin II, PhD, LPC, LMFT-A, NCC, CCMHC, is currently an assistant professor in the Professional Counseling Program at the University of Mary Hardin Baylor and serves as the program’s clinical coordinator. He is also in private practice in Temple, Texas, working with individuals, couples, and families. Julius A. Austin, PhD, LPC, NCC, is currently a clinical therapist and the coordinator for the Office of Substance Abuse and Recovery at Tulane University.
